Steen Dalby Kristensen is affiliated with Aarhus University Hospital in Denmark. Their research primarily focuses on medicine, with a strong emphasis on cardiology and cardiovascular medicine. Their work spans several related subfields including surgery, radiology, nuclear medicine and imaging, internal medicine, and pulmonary and respiratory medicine.

The scientist has contributed extensively to topics within cardiology, particularly in areas such as coronary interventions and diagnostics, antiplatelet therapy and cardiovascular diseases, acute myocardial infarction research, cardiac imaging and diagnostics, as well as venous thromboembolism diagnosis and management. Additional topics of investigation include cardiovascular and exercise physiology and transplantation methods and outcomes.
